Who is Lewis Stevens?

Lewis David Stevens is a British Conservative Party politician.

On his second attempt, Stevens was elected Member of Parliament for the marginal seat of Nuneaton in 1983, after the retirement of Labour incumbent Les Huckfield. He served until his defeat by Labour's Bill Olner at the 1992 general election.

Subsequently, he serves as President of the Nuneaton Conservative Association.
